ABSTRACT:
A superconducting magnet device includes a superconducting coil for generating a magnetostatic field, and a pulsating magentic field generating coil disposed on the inner diameter side of the superconducting coil. An inner cylinder of a thermal shielding tank located between the superconducting coil and the pulating magentic field generating coil is maintained at a temperature equal to or lower than the liquid nitrogen temperature. The inner cylinder is made of a superconductor which becomes superconductive at a temperature equal to or higher than the liquid nitrogen temperature. Further, a heating wire for heating the inner cylinder which is in a superconductive state to cause it to become normal conductive is provided on the inner cylinder of the thermal shielding tank in a direction in which it cuts across an induced current loop generated by the excitation of the static magnetic field.
